Branch led Open water diving expeditions and instruction courses for 2023

Any precise listing of diving events in and around our shores is fraught with unpredictable weather conditions. The tides we can deal with, the weather has a mind of its own and for safe diving, times and locations of expeditions are adjusted accordingly. Nowadays, last minute communications about planned diving expeditions are made by the Dive Manager via text messaging or WhatsApp.

The emphasis is on safe diving. Plan the dive and dive the plan.

This year’s list of events is a broad overview of envisaged expeditions and locations. Otherwise, expeditions will be planned and expedited by experienced Divers in consultation with the diving officer and members’ wish list for dives and locations.
